Message type: E = Error
Message class: SRT_WSP2 - Messages for SRT WSP
Message number: 359
Message text: Failed to get constant value of 'CL_SEC_SXML_WRITER=>CO_TDES_ALGORITHM'

- Failed to get constant value of 'CL_SEC_SXML_WRITER=>CO_TDES_ALGORITHM' ?The SAP error message SRT_WSP2359 indicates that there is an issue related to the constant value of
CL_SEC_SXML_WRITER=>CO_TDES_ALGORITHM
. This error typically arises in the context of web service communication, particularly when dealing with security settings for XML writers in SAP.Cause:
- Missing or Incomplete Configuration: The constant
CO_TDES_ALGORITHM
is likely not defined or is incorrectly configured in the system. This can happen if the necessary security settings for web services are not properly set up.- System Upgrade or Patch: If the system has recently been upgraded or patched, it is possible that some components related to web service security have not been updated correctly.
- Authorization Issues: There may be authorization issues preventing the system from accessing the required constants or classes.
- Corrupted or Missing Classes: The class
CL_SEC_SXML_WRITER
itself may be corrupted or missing, leading to the inability to retrieve the constant.Solution:
- Check Configuration: Verify the configuration settings for web services in transaction
SOAMANAGER
. Ensure that all necessary security settings are correctly configured.- Check for Updates: Ensure that your SAP system is up to date with the latest patches and updates. Sometimes, missing updates can lead to such errors.
- Authorization Check: Ensure that the user has the necessary authorizations to access the web service and the related classes.
- Class Verification: Use transaction
SE80
orSE24
to check if the classCL_SEC_SXML_WRITER
exists and is not corrupted. If it is missing, you may need to restore it from a backup or re-import it from the transport.- Consult SAP Notes: Check the SAP Support Portal for any relevant SAP Notes that might address this specific error. There may be known issues or patches available.
- Debugging: If you have access to the development environment, you can debug the code to see where the failure occurs and gather more information about the context of the error.
